Yuk! Belajar Komponen-Komponen Pemrograman Pascal!
Sebelum membahas komponen-komponen bahasa pemrograman Pascal, lebih baik kita mengenal sedikit tentang apa itu Pascal. Sementara itu tidak ada salahnya menambah ilmu dan memperuas wawasan bukan? Kita bisa jadi lebih banyak pengetahuan!
Langsung saja! Berikut penjelasannya!
Bahasa Pemrograman Pascal adalah bahasa pemrograman komputer yang sering di gunakan untuk belajar tentang algoritma dan pemrograman bagi pemula yang baru belajar terutama di bidang akademis.
Orang yang menemukan bahasa pemrograman Pascal ini bernama Niklaus Wirth dan di kembangkan pada tahun 1970 dan mencapai puncaknya pada era 1970 hingga awal 1990-an. Di sisi lain nama Pascal di ambil dari ahli matematika Prancis pada abad pertengahan, Blaise Pascal.
Bahasa pemrograman Pascal menerapkan konsep peosedur dan struktur sehingga cocok untuk belajar Programing. Sehingga proses belajar menjadi sangat di permudah.
Bahasa pemrograman Pascal mempunyai fungsi membantu mewujudkan pemecahan suatu masalah sederhana hingga program bisa semakin mudah di ubah maupun dimodifikasi. Setelah sedikit perkenalan maka selanjutnya adalah aturan yang ada pada Pascal.
Aturan Bahasa Pemrograman Pascal
Seperti bahasa pemrograman lainnya yang memiliki aturannya Bahasa pemrograman Pascal juga mempunyai aturan tersendir dalam penulisan programnya. Aturan-aturan tersebut juga harus di taati apabila tidak ingin terjadi eror pada program yang di buat.
Berikut beberapa aturan yang perlu di pelajari :
- Paling pertama adalah akhir dari program Pascal harus di tandai dengan tanda baca titik [ . ] setelah END yang paling akhir.
- Lalu jika ingin memisahkan antar intruksi satu dengan instruksi lainnya sertakanlah tanda koma [ , ]
- Kemudian beberapa statement boleh di tulis menjadi satu baris dengan syarat di pisahkan oleh tanda baca titik koma [ ; ]
- Baris kometar di letakan di antara tanda kurung buka [ ( ] dan kurung tutup [ ) ] atau di antara tanda kurung awal [ { ] dan kurung akhir [ } ] atau juga setelah tanda [ // ]
Komponen-Komponen Pascal
Sementara kita telah memahami materi di atas kita kan mempelajari komponen-komponen bahasa pemrograman Pascal. Makan selanjutnya bahasa pemrograman Pascal memiliki pola susun bahasa yang di bentuk dengan menggunakan omponen bahasa pemrograman umum dan itu adalah;
- Yang pertama adalah Simbol Dasar,
- Yang kedua adalah Kata Pasti ( Reserved Word ),
- dana yang terakhir adalah Penyebut ( Identifier ).
Berikut penjelasan lengkap dari ketiga komponen bahasa pemrograman pascal :
Simbol dasar
Di samping itu Simbol dasar terdiri dari :
- Huruf, yaitu huruf [ A ] sampai dengan huruf [ Z ] atau huruf [ a ] sampai dengan huruf [ z ] (hufnya besar dan kecil).
- Angka atau digit, yaitu : [ 0, 1, 2, 3, 4, 5, 6, 7, 8, 9. ]
- Khusus, yaitu : + – * / ; : , ‘ = >= <= > < <> {} [] ()
Kata Pasti ( Reserved Word )
Resserved Word adalah kata yang secara mutlak tidak boleh di artikan sebagai yang lain dan harus di gunakan sebagaimana yang telah di defenisikan atau di tentukan fungsinya oleh bahasa Pascal. Reserved word tidak boleh di definisikan ulang oleh pemakai sehingga tidak keliru atau di gunakan sebagai pengenal atau identifier.
Berikut contoh reserved word :
AND | ELSE | LABEL | SET |
ARRAY | AND | OF | TYPE |
BEGIN | FUNCTION | OR | UNTIL |
CASE | FOR | PROSEDUR | THEN |
COSNT | GOTO | PROGRAM | VAR |
DO | IF | RECORD | WHILE |
DOWNTO | IN | REPEAT | WITH |
Pengenal ( Identifier )
Selanjutnya adalah Identifier, sebuah kata yang di beritahukan oleh programer dan di gunakan sebagai sebutan atau sebuah nama pada sesuatu di dalam program. Kenapa? Karena pemakai bisa mendefinissikan sendiri suatu nama sebagai identifier dan identifier bisa di gunakan untuk menyatakan nama sesuatu seperti ; program, konstanta, varialble, fungsi, objek dan lain-lain.
Selain itu indentifier terdiri atas :
- Yang pertama Non Standar, yang di definisikan oleh pemakai seperti nama suatu program, konstanta, variabel, atau prosedure.
- Yang kedua Standar, di definisikan oleh bahasa pemrograman Pascal.
Di bawah ini adalah contoh selanjutnya dari identifier standar:
ABS | COS | EOF |
ARCTAN | CHR | EOLN |
BOOLEAN | CHAR | EXP |
LN | READLN | AQR |
ODB | READ | ASQRT |
PRED | ROUND | AUCC |
- Bebas, identifier ini bebas namundengan ketentuan-ketentuan sebagai berikut :
- Terdiri dari gabungan hurf dan angka denga karakter pertama harus berupa huruf.
- Selanjutnya tidak boleh ada blank di dalamnya.
- Setelahnya tidak boleh memakai simbol-simbol khusus kecuali garis bawah.
- Lalu panjang karakternya bebas tetapi hanya 63 karakter pertama yang di anggap signifikan.
Editor : Sulistianingsih